Linux编程基础:文本操作与文件管理
需积分: 12 71 浏览量
更新于2024-08-25
收藏 2.21MB PPT 举报
本文档主要探讨了Linux编程基础中的关键操作和文件管理,涵盖了文本编辑和处理的各个方面。以下是详细的内容概要:
1. 文本操作:
- 插入文本:通过相应的快捷键或命令,可以在Linux编辑器中方便地插入新文本,这对于编写代码或编辑文档非常重要。
- 删除文本:同样有相应的快捷键或命令,允许用户精确地删除指定的文本内容。
- 取消操作:在Linux编程中,撤销和重做功能也很重要,帮助程序员避免误操作。
- 粘贴操作:无论是复制内容后粘贴,还是使用剪贴板功能,Linux提供了相应的工具支持。
- 查找和替换:这对于查找并修改大量文本中的特定模式非常实用,通常可通过搜索命令或编辑器内置的功能实现。
2. 文件操作:
- 使用`C-x C-f`快捷键可以在Linux环境中打开文件浏览器,允许用户输入文件路径,选择并定位需要编辑的文件。
- `C-x C-s`用于保存文件,系统会提示文件所在目录和文件名,确保数据安全地存储在磁盘上。
3. Linux编程风格:
- 提倡清晰的代码结构,包括函数的返回类型和名称应分别占据两行,遵循左花括号与函数起始位置对齐的原则。
- 避免在同一行混合不同优先级的运算符,通过添加括号来增强代码可读性。
- 对do-while语句有特定的排版规则,强调代码整洁。
- 注释的重要性不容忽视,每个程序应有简要的功能说明,而每个函数则需详细描述其作用、参数、预期值及其用途。
4. IDE使用和开发环境:
- 讨论了在Linux下使用IDE(集成开发环境)进行程序开发的过程,如GNUcc(GCC)编译器的应用。
- 提到Linux下的软件开发环境是活跃且全球化的,很多开源项目在这里孕育并成长。
5. 软件管理:
- 强调了GNU软件的广泛使用,以及它们的自由软件性质和可靠性。
- RCS/CVS版本控制系统在Linux开发中的运用,帮助管理和追踪代码变更。
总结起来,本文档为学习Linux编程的初学者提供了重要的基础知识,包括文本和文件操作技巧,以及编程风格和开发环境的配置。通过理解和实践这些内容,读者可以更有效地进行Linux程序设计和维护。
169 浏览量
2009-04-22 上传
2018-12-21 上传
2021-11-14 上传
143 浏览量
2020-10-13 上传
2022-11-19 上传
2009-11-19 上传
2007-10-17 上传
速本
- 粉丝: 20
- 资源: 2万+
最新资源
- abaqus入门教程
- android programming 1
- java编程规范(经典)
- CD4066与CD4069组成的二维图形变幻彩灯控制器的电路分析与制作
- Liunx文件系统基本目录介绍大全.doc
- java个人学习笔记
- rationa.统一开发过程.软件开发者的最佳实践
- Flex3 CookBook
- 土地二次调查入库流程
- 玩转12864液晶(带字库的,画点,画线)
- Office使用的100个窍门和小提示
- 经典c语言源程序100例
- IEEE Std 1364™-2005
- 程序员的SQL金典 第一本专门为程序员编写的数据库图书
- Professional Android Application Development
- 《C语言程序设计》谭浩强第三版课后答案